✨Know Your Projects Inside Out
Before the interview, make sure you thoroughly understand the major civil engineering and infrastructure projects you've worked on. Be ready to discuss specific challenges you faced, how you overcame them, and the impact of your leadership on project outcomes.
✨Showcase Your Leadership Skills
As a Project Director, your leadership style is crucial. Prepare examples that highlight your ability to manage multi-disciplinary teams and foster strong stakeholder relationships. Think about times when you successfully navigated conflicts or motivated your team to achieve project goals.
✨Understand the Company’s Vision
Research the Tier 1 Main Contractor you’re interviewing with. Understand their values, recent projects, and future goals. This will help you align your answers with their vision and demonstrate your genuine interest in contributing to their success.
✨Prepare for Scenario-Based Questions
Expect scenario-based questions that assess your problem-solving abilities in complex project environments. Practice articulating your thought process and decision-making strategies, especially in relation to driving programme performance and ensuring operational excellence.
